&#60;p&#62;It is an autoimmune disorder and she has to take steroids for flare-ups and get her eyes checked regularly.  She also takes a daily immunosuppressant.  The person you need to see is a rheumatologist or an immunologist.  I would check your insurance, call them up to make sure this is something they have seen and treated before, and get a referral.  My mother lives in the middle of nowhere and it took about a year and a half before someone crossed her path who knew what was going on with her.
